Our database contains 2 NHTSA owner-reported complaints for the 1989 International Harvester 3000, most frequently naming the body & structure and steering categories. 1 safety recall has been issued covering this model year.
Complaints are reports submitted by owners and drivers to NHTSA. They are not verified and do not establish that a defect exists.

FRAME OF VEHICLE HAS CRACKED WHICH COULD EVENTUALLY CAUSE FRONT END OF THE BUS TO DROP. *AK

POWER STEERING FAILURE, HIGH PRESSURE POWER STEERING LINE RUPTURED AND LEAKED POWER STEERING FLUID, COULD CAUSE A FIRE, FLEET OF SCHOOL BUSES. TT
